diff --git a/kicad-footprints/Jumper.pretty/S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m.kicad_mod b/kicad-footprints/Jumper.pretty/S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m.kicad_mod index 68995648..c9ed705c 100644 --- a/kicad-footprints/Jumper.pretty/S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m.kicad_mod +++ b/kicad-footprints/Jumper.pretty/S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m.kicad_mod @@ -1,4 +1,4 @@ -(module S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m (layer F.Cu) (tedit 5B391E66) +(module S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m (layer F.Cu) (tedit 61A787ED) (descr "SMD Solder Jumper, 1x1.5mm, rounded Pads, 0.3mm gap, open") (tags "solder jumper open") (attr virtual) @@ -8,18 +8,18 @@ (fp_text value SolderJumper-2_P1.3mm_Open_RoundedPad1.0x1.5mm (at 0 1.9) (layer F.Fab) (effects (font (size 1 1) (thickness 0.15))) ) + (fp_line (start 1.3 1) (end -1.3 1) (layer F.CrtYd) (width 0.05)) + (fp_line (start 1.3 1) (end 1.3 -1) (layer F.CrtYd) (width 0.05)) + (fp_line (start -1.3 -1) (end -1.3 1) (layer F.CrtYd) (width 0.05)) + (fp_line (start -1.3 -1) (end 1.3 -1) (layer F.CrtYd) (width 0.05)) + (fp_line (start -0.7 -1) (end 0.7 -1) (layer F.SilkS) (width 0.12)) + (fp_line (start 1.4 -0.3) (end 1.4 0.3) (layer F.SilkS) (width 0.12)) + (fp_line (start 0.7 1) (end -0.7 1) (layer F.SilkS) (width 0.12)) + (fp_line (start -1.4 0.3) (end -1.4 -0.3) (layer F.SilkS) (width 0.12)) (fp_arc (start 0.7 -0.3) (end 1.4 -0.3) (angle -90) (layer F.SilkS) (width 0.12)) (fp_arc (start 0.7 0.3) (end 0.7 1) (angle -90) (layer F.SilkS) (width 0.12)) (fp_arc (start -0.7 0.3) (end -1.4 0.3) (angle -90) (layer F.SilkS) (width 0.12)) (fp_arc (start -0.7 -0.3) (end -0.7 -1) (angle -90) (layer F.SilkS) (width 0.12)) - (fp_line (start -1.4 0.3) (end -1.4 -0.3) (layer F.SilkS) (width 0.12)) - (fp_line (start 0.7 1) (end -0.7 1) (layer F.SilkS) (width 0.12)) - (fp_line (start 1.4 -0.3) (end 1.4 0.3) (layer F.SilkS) (width 0.12)) - (fp_line (start -0.7 -1) (end 0.7 -1) (layer F.SilkS) (width 0.12)) - (fp_line (start -1.65 -1.25) (end 1.65 -1.25) (layer F.CrtYd) (width 0.05)) - (fp_line (start -1.65 -1.25) (end -1.65 1.25) (layer F.CrtYd) (width 0.05)) - (fp_line (start 1.65 1.25) (end 1.65 -1.25) (layer F.CrtYd) (width 0.05)) - (fp_line (start 1.65 1.25) (end -1.65 1.25) (layer F.CrtYd) (width 0.05)) (pad 1 smd custom (at -0.65 0) (size 1 0.5) (layers F.Cu F.Mask) (zone_connect 2) (options (clearance outline) (anchor rect)) diff --git a/kicad-symbols/RF_Module.bck b/kicad-symbols/RF_Module.bck index 5f3ed79b..6115955b 100644 --- a/kicad-symbols/RF_Module.bck +++ b/kicad-symbols/RF_Module.bck @@ -1,3 +1,7 @@ EESchema-DOCLIB Version 2.0 # +$CMP ESP32-S3 +F https://www.espressif.com/sites/default/files/documentation/esp32-s3_datasheet_en.pdf +$ENDCMP +# #End Doc Library diff --git a/kicad-symbols/RF_Module.dcm b/kicad-symbols/RF_Module.dcm index 5f3ed79b..6115955b 100644 --- a/kicad-symbols/RF_Module.dcm +++ b/kicad-symbols/RF_Module.dcm @@ -1,3 +1,7 @@ EESchema-DOCLIB Version 2.0 # +$CMP ESP32-S3 +F https://www.espressif.com/sites/default/files/documentation/esp32-s3_datasheet_en.pdf +$ENDCMP +# #End Doc Library diff --git a/kicad-symbols/RF_Module.lib b/kicad-symbols/RF_Module.lib index e6d72fb1..5c7b7c1a 100644 --- a/kicad-symbols/RF_Module.lib +++ b/kicad-symbols/RF_Module.lib @@ -790,4 +790,79 @@ X GPIO4 9 2200 -550 300 L 59 59 1 1 B ENDDRAW ENDDEF # +# ESP32-S3 +# +DEF ESP32-S3 U? 0 10 Y Y 1 F N +F0 "U?" 1750 700 60 H V C CNN +F1 "ESP32-S3" 1800 -4000 60 H V C CNN +F2 "QFN56_ESP32_7X7_EXP" 1850 -4100 60 H I C CNN +F3 "" -1150 -700 60 H I C CNN +F4 "ESP32-S3FN8" 0 0 50 H I C CNN "ORDERCODE" +$FPLIST + QFN56_ESP32_7X7_EXP + QFN56_ESP32_7X7_EXP-M + QFN56_ESP32_7X7_EXP-L +$ENDFPLIST +DRAW +S 300 650 1900 -3950 0 1 0 f +X LNA_IN 1 2200 200 300 L 59 59 1 1 P +X GPIO5 10 2200 -650 300 L 59 59 1 1 B +X GPIO6 11 2200 -750 300 L 59 59 1 1 B +X GPIO7 12 2200 -850 300 L 59 59 1 1 B +X GPIO8 13 2200 -950 300 L 59 59 1 1 B +X GPIO9 14 2200 -1050 300 L 59 59 1 1 B +X GPIO10 15 2200 -1150 300 L 59 59 1 1 B +X GPIO11 16 2200 -1250 300 L 59 59 1 1 B +X GPIO12 17 2200 -1350 300 L 59 59 1 1 B +X GPIO13 18 2200 -1450 300 L 59 59 1 1 B +X GPIO14 19 2200 -1550 300 L 59 59 1 1 B +X VDD3P3 2 1250 950 300 D 59 59 1 1 W +X VDD3P3_RTC 20 1050 950 300 D 59 59 1 1 W +X 32K_P/GPIO15 21 2200 -1650 300 L 59 59 1 1 B +X 32K_N/GPIO16 22 2200 -1750 300 L 59 59 1 1 B +X DAC1/GPIO17 23 2200 -1850 300 L 59 59 1 1 B +X DAC_2/GPIO18 24 2200 -1950 300 L 59 59 1 1 B +X GPIO19/D- 25 0 -400 300 R 59 59 1 1 B +X GPIO20/D+ 26 0 -300 300 R 59 59 1 1 B +X GPIO21 27 2200 -2050 300 L 59 59 1 1 B +X SPIS1/~PSR_CS 28 0 -850 300 R 59 59 1 1 O +X VDD_SPI 29 0 -3500 300 R 59 59 1 1 w +X VDD3P3 3 1150 950 300 D 59 59 1 1 W +X SPIHD/~HOLD~/SIO3 30 0 -1350 300 R 59 59 1 1 O +X SPIWP/~WP~/SIO2 31 0 -1250 300 R 59 59 1 1 O +X SPIS0/~FLASH_CS 32 0 -750 300 R 59 59 1 1 B +X SPICLK 33 0 -950 300 R 59 59 1 1 B +X SPIQ/D0/SIO1 34 0 -1150 300 R 59 59 1 1 B +X SPID/DI/SIO0 35 0 -1050 300 R 59 59 1 1 B +X SPICLK_N/GPIO48 36 2200 -3650 300 L 59 59 1 1 O +X SPICLK_P/GPIO47 37 2200 -3550 300 L 59 59 1 1 O +X GPIO33 38 2200 -2150 300 L 59 59 1 1 B +X GPIO34 39 2200 -2250 300 L 59 59 1 1 B +X CHIP_PU 4 0 200 300 R 59 59 1 1 I +X GPIO35 40 2200 -2350 300 L 59 59 1 1 B +X GPIO36 41 2200 -2450 300 L 59 59 1 1 B +X GPIO37 42 2200 -2550 300 L 59 59 1 1 B +X GPIO38 43 2200 -2650 300 L 59 59 1 1 B +X MTCK/GPIO39 44 2200 -2750 300 L 59 59 1 1 B +X MTDO/GPIO40 45 2200 -2850 300 L 59 59 1 1 B +X VDD3P3_CPU 46 1450 950 300 D 59 59 1 1 W +X MTDI/GPIO41 47 2200 -2950 300 L 59 59 1 1 B +X MTMS/GPIO42 48 2200 -3050 300 L 59 59 1 1 B +X U0TXD/GPIO43 49 2200 -3150 300 L 59 59 1 1 B +X BOOT0/GPIO0 5 0 -2500 300 R 59 59 1 1 B +X U0RXD/GPIO44 50 2200 -3250 300 L 59 59 1 1 B +X VDD_SPI_SEL/GPIO45 51 0 -2800 300 R 59 59 1 1 B +X BOOT1/GPIO46 52 0 -2600 300 R 59 59 1 1 B +X XTAL_N 53 0 -2150 300 R 59 59 1 1 I +X XTAL_P 54 0 -2050 300 R 59 59 1 1 I +X VDDA 55 750 950 300 D 59 59 1 1 W +X VDDA 56 950 950 300 D 59 59 1 1 W +X GND 57 1050 -4250 300 U 59 59 1 1 W +X GPIO1 6 2200 -250 300 L 59 59 1 1 B +X GPIO2 7 2200 -350 300 L 59 59 1 1 B +X JTAG_SEL/GPIO3 8 0 -2900 300 R 59 59 1 1 B +X GPIO4 9 2200 -550 300 L 59 59 1 1 B +ENDDRAW +ENDDEF +# #End Library